The accolade trailer for Kena: Bridge of Spirits is finally here, celebrating the game’s arrival on the Nintendo Switch 2. Developer Ember Lab shared the new trailer to highlight the strong reception from critics, as well as the excitement among players stepping into Kena’s world alongside her charming Rot companions.
With its launch on Nintendo’s latest platform, players can now experience the full version of the game, including the previously released Anniversary DLC. This expanded edition brings in Charmstones, Spirit Guide Trials, new outfits for Kena, and additional accessibility options. The Switch 2 version also includes a New Game+ mode, allowing players to revisit the journey with all previously unlocked abilities, upgrades, and companions, while facing tougher, reworked combat encounters that add a fresh layer of challenge.
Originally released in September 2021 for PlayStation platforms, Kena: Bridge of Spirits quickly earned critical acclaim and went on to win Best Independent Game and Best Debut Indie Game at The Game Awards 2021. The game blends exploration, puzzle-solving, and fast-paced combat within a beautifully crafted world. Players take on the role of Kena, a young Spirit Guide, as she uncovers the mysteries of a forgotten village and helps lost spirits move on.
Kena: Bridge of Spirits is now available on Nintendo Switch 2 across North America, Europe, and Asia, with a Taiwan release date to be confirmed. The game is also playable on PC, PlayStation, and Xbox platforms.
